The size of Bellevue is approximately 3.0 square kilometres. There are 11 parks, covering nearly 25.0% of the total area. The population of Bellevue in 2016 was 1521 people. By 2021 the population was 1514 showing a population decline of 0.5%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Bellevue is 30-39 years. Households in Bellevue are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1400 - $1799 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Bellevue work in a trades occupation.In 2021, 67.20% of the homes in Bellevue were owner-occupied compared with 72.40% in 2016.
